What are the advantages of lithium-ion batteries over lead-acid batteries? Lithium-ion batteries have several advantages over lead-acid batteries. They are lighter, have a longer lifespan, and can be charged more quickly. They are also more efficient and have a higher energy density, meaning they can store more energy in a smaller package.

What is Lithium Battery? A lithium battery is a type of power source that uses lithium, a lightweight metal, to store energy. It can be recharged many times and is used in things like phones, laptops, and electric cars because it lasts longer and is more powerful than other batteries. Mercury batteries have some advantages and disadvantages compared to other types of batteries. Some of the advantages are: They have a long shelf life of up to 10 years. They have steady voltage output. They have high energy density and capacity compared to other primary batteries. They have good performance at low temperatures and high currents.

Alkaline batteries have some advantages and disadvantages compared to other types of batteries. Some of the advantages are: They have high energy density and capacity compared to other primary batteries. They have a long shelf life and low self-discharge rate. They have good performance at high currents and low temperatures.
